Hello, Scrapbook & Cards Today friends! It’s Becki here to share with you a set of birthday tags that I created, along with a bonus layout! I’m so excited to share the Hey Cupcake collection by Doodlebug with you. I think this is the perfect collection for celebrating SCT’s 17th birthday week.
Supplies | Doodlebug Hey Cupcake collection: patterned paper, chit chat die cuts, odds, and ends die cuts, enamel dots, Doodle-Pops; Hobby Lobby: ribbon, pom-pom trim; American Crafts: cardstock; Scrapbook.com: adhesive; Scrapbook Adhesives by 3L: foam squares
I started by creating the base for three tags. These tags are cut out of 12×12 paper into a 4×6. I’m planning on adding these tags to small white gift bags so I wanted them to be big! After cutting the paper to size, I trimmed off the corners to create the tag shape.
The little girls in the Hey Cupcake collection are so cute!! I couldn’t help but add a few of them to my tags. I especially loved the Doodle-pop stickers with these sweet girls. I love the pop of texture and a little bit of shine from these cute little stickers!
Another element from the Hey Cupcake collection that I couldn’t resist was the cake and cupcakes. They’re so cute!! They make me hungry for a yummy birthday cake. I can almost taste that sweet, fluffy frosting!
To finish each of these tags, I added some ribbon and pom-pom trim. I think these are the perfect finishing touch to these tags. If a little bit of pom-pom trim doesn’t make you smile, are you even a crafter? LOL!
